The new Gen 3 Stages Power meter is built onto a Shimano Ultegra R8000 crankset. The Stages Power meter is placed on both the drive and non-drive side of the crank to independently measure a rider's left and right legs.
Tour proven
Stages Power has carried riders to three consecutive Tour de France victories, plus many more world and national championships. If you believe racing provides the world’s best product proving ground, then Stages Power is proven as one of the world’s best power meters.
Active temperature compensation as standard equipment
Consistency of measurement is the most important feature of a power meter. Stages Power was the first meter to make temperature compensation an automatic process, ensuring accurate readings no matter the environmental conditions.
Individual meter calibration for accurate results
Stages Power meters are calibrated individually to ensure a +/- 1.5% accuracy level. Individual calibration means that you can trust the data produced by the Stages system.

accuracy | ± 1.5% |
water resistance rating | IPX7 |
weight | Only adds 35g to base crank arm |
power range (watts) | 0 to 2500 |
battery life | 175+ hours (coin cell CR2032) when used as a single-sided meter |
cadence range (rpm) | 20-220 |
